I think the first step is going to be doing your research. It's a must-do homework for any starter. Also, you might wanna think about starting small. Your chance of surviving will double if you start small. Even if you have unlimited amount of budget, you wouldn't need to worry about anything complicated if you start small. At the end of the day , you still learn about this business. Because what you have now is only and iDEA. You don't know the market yet, you don't know the competition yet, you don't know what it takes to be successfull in that particular industry.

Don't worry, any business, if you know how to run it, will grow by itself.

Write down anything your creative mind think. Make a goal and a plan how to reach that goal. Read good books, it'll help.
